Automatic Data Processing, Inc. (NASDAQ:ADP) Shares Sold by Wolverine Asset Management LLC

Wolverine Asset Management LLC reduced its position in Automatic Data Processing, Inc. (NASDAQ:ADPFree Report) by 44.4% in the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The fund owned 2,500 shares of the business services provider’s stock after selling 2,000 shares during the quarter. Wolverine Asset Management LLC’s holdings in Automatic Data Processing were worth $732,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Automatic Data Processing Profile

(Free Report)

Automatic Data Processing, Inc provides cloud-based human capital management solutions worldwide. It operates in two segments, Employer Services and Professional Employer Organization (PEO). The Employer Services segment offers strategic, cloud-based platforms, and human resources (HR) outsourcing solutions.
